# ThumbVault image cache — new folks, read this first.
# This constant limits the number of decoded bitmaps held
# in the cache. We once let it grow unbounded and the Orrelin
# gallery view leaked roughly 40MB per scroll session because
# evicted entries kept strong references in the prefetch map.
# Keep this low and always pair insertions with the release
# hook two files down. The leak-regression job stamps its
# token immediately below this block.

pipeline stamp: htk31_f769b577b3028a4e9958e5bb8d1259a

// MAX_SCAN_PAYLOAD_BYTES caps raw input from the Corvid handheld
// scanners before parsing. Security note: scanners are untrusted
// input sources; oversized or malformed frames must be rejected
// before they reach the decoder, which has had buffer issues
// historically. Do not raise this limit without updating the fuzz
// corpus. The decoder hardening landed in the firmware build
// identified by the token below.

pipeline stamp: htk21_86b657ac0aa916a9af17f

Handover from Priya Andel to Marcus Vey. The Larkfield pilot lost nine of forty customers last quarter, mostly citing onboarding friction. Refund exposure is modest and already accrued. Retention fixes are scoped for October. Finance should hold the pilot reserve unchanged. Context for these decisions sits in the note below.

board note of kagep-yahig: Only 9 of the 120 pilot accounts renewed Quenix, so a churn review is set for April 1.

## Build Provenance: Soundspindle Waveform Preview

Every release of the Soundspindle audio waveform preview component is built on the Hallowmere pipeline from a tagged commit. As a new contractor, always verify that the artifact you are testing matches an official pipeline run before filing defects. The provenance record for the current preview build appears directly below.

build token for kagaf-hahof: htk14_9d3d4d26d7d8de